Output 76eb616472971d6a5aa11186988aa2b44ccaf66dbaec8a1d82aed703c5823226:1

value
18262136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a42ee97a43963348a57e532a74b42ffe6302afc1 OP_EQUAL
address
3Gf8wWSPXfs1YraUQyJEoYMLP7NAcT8LJg
transaction
76eb616472971d6a5aa11186988aa2b44ccaf66dbaec8a1d82aed703c5823226
spent
true